Re: Epidemiological evidence of lung cancer risk



I can't find anything completely specific to nuclear

medicine technicians but the following may be close --



Petralia SA, Dosemeci M, Adams EE, Zahm SH.  1999.

Cancer mortality among women employed in health care

occupations in 24 U.S. states,

1984-1993.   Am J Ind Med. 36(1):159-165.

Mohan A, Hauptmann M, Doody M, Freedman D, Alexander

B, Boice J, Mandel J,  Correa-Villasenor A, Matanoski

G, Linet M.  2000.   Mortality among radiologic

technologists in the united states (1926-1997). 2(nd)

Follow up.   Ann Epidemiol. 10(7):480.

Doody MM, Mandel JS, Boice JD Jr.  1995.  Employment

practices and breast cancer among radiologic

technologists.  J Occup Environ Med. 37(3):321-327.

Doody MM, Mandel JS, Lubin JH, Boice JD Jr.  1998  

Mortality among United States radiologic

technologists, 1926-90.    Cancer Causes Control.

9(1):67-75.

Boice JD Jr, Mandel JS, Doody MM.  1995.  Breast

cancer among radiologic technologists.  JAMA.  Aug

2;274(5):394-401.

Morin Doody M, Mandel JS, Linet MS, Ron E, Lubin JH,

Boice JD Jr, Fraumeni JF Jr.  2000.  Mortality among

Catholic nuns certified as radiologic technologists.  

Am J Ind Med. 37(4):339-348.

Sont WN, Zielinski JM, Ashmore JP, Jiang H, Krewski D,

Fair ME, Band PR, Letourneau EG.   2001.  First

analysis of cancer incidence and occupational

radiation exposure based on the National Dose 

Registry of Canada.   Am J Epidemiol.  153(4):309-318.
